Liverpool host Sparta Prague in the second leg of their Europa League Round of 16 tie at Anfield on Thursday. The Reds hold a comprehensive 5-1 lead from the game in the Czech capital a week ago, which makes this game at Anfield almost a formality. With a key FA Cup game at the weekend against Manchester United, Jurgen Klopp is likely to remain key players for this game. For Sparta Prague, it is a chance at redemption after losing 5-1 to the Reds last week and then 4-0 at Viktoria Plzen at the weekend.

Liverpool - Sparta Prague: Form Analysis

With a four goal lead and the home leg to play, you can expect Jurgen Klopp to rotate a number of players who played in the weekend's 1-1 draw with Manchester City. That means players like Darwin Nunez, Virgil Van Dijk, Mo Salah, Dominic Szoboszlai, Wataru Endo, Alexis MacAllister and Andy Robertson could be rested for this game. The Reds come into the game unbeaten at Anfield and even with a team packed with youngsters, should still be confident of landing a win. The draw with Manchester City knocked Liverpool off the top of the Premier League table on goal difference but they have still won eight of the last 10, drawing one and losing just the one. That in the midst of a horrific injury crisis is remarkable by the Red Machine. 

Sparta Prague manager Brian Priske stated his team were better value than the 5-1 defeat they suffered at Liverpool's hands last week suggested. He also bravely suggested his team will once again play an attacking game against the Reds at Anfield in the second leg. It is a brave call, especially seeing as they followed the big defeat to Liverpool with a 4-0 loss to Viktoria Plzen in the league. That now makes it three games without a win for Sparta, and their place at the top of the Czechia League Table is looking far less secure as a result. Priske does have a point in that Liverpool were very clinical in that first game, but it would be nothing short of incredible if Sparta can make a real game of this in the second leg.

Liverpool & Sparta Prague Squad Analysis

Liverpool boss Jurgen Klopp already knows that Alisson, Joel Matip, Ryan Gravenberch, Trent Alexander-Arnold, Diogo Jota, Curtis Jones and Thiago will all be absent for the game through injury. French defender Ibrahima Konate also missed the game with Manchester City, while Mo Salah was only fit enough to make the bench. Darwin Nunez and Dominik Szoboszlai started, but the likelihood is they will be rested by Klopp with youngsters such as Bobby Clarke, Lewis Koumas, Jayden Danns and James McDonell likely to be given a chance. Cody Gakpo should start after being substitute against City, as should Kostas Tsimikas. Alexis MacAllister had his best game for Liverpool against City at the weekend, but the Argentinean may be another player to start from the bench as Klopp rotates his squad given the big lead his team have from the first leg. 

Sparta Prague manager Brian Priske will be without two players for the Europa League second leg tie with Liverpool at Anfield. Long-term absentee right back Andreas Vindheim remains out and will likely not feature this season. Asger Sorensen picked up a hamstring injury before the game with Liverpool and also sat out the loss to Viktoria Plzen at the weekend and he is unlikely to be fit to play in the second leg either. Should Sparta pull off a miracle comeback, Kaan Kairinen in midfield will need to be careful as he is just one booking away from a suspension that would rule him out of the quarterfinal first leg. That should be academic though given what happened in the first leg in Prague. 

Liverpool - Sparta Prague Key Points

  1. Liverpool are unbeaten at home at Anfield this season, winning all their games at home except for three draws in the Premier League against Arsenal, Manchester United and Manchester City.
  2. Sparta Prague have not won any of their last three games, drawing with Slavia 0-0, before losing to Liverpool 5-1 and they then lost 4-0 away to Viktoria Plzen at the weekend.
  3. Cody Gakpo has scored twice and assisted in one goal in the Europa League so far for Liverpool. However of the four players that have scored more often in the tournament for Liverpool, only Luis Diaz is likely to start the second leg tie at Anfield.
  4. Both teams have scored in six of Sparta Prague's last eight games. Similarly, both teams have found the net in 9 of Liverpool's last 12 games.
  5. Liverpool are very likely to rest key players for this game as they played Manchester City last weekend at Anfield (drawing 1-1) and will face a trip to Old Trafford to take on Manchester United in the FA Cup in this coming weekend.

The game took place in the Czechia capital on Thursday last week and saw Liverpool emerge with a very comfortable 5-1 victory against the hosts, despite playing a team that included a number of younger and inexperienced players. 

The Reds got off to a great start when Alexis Mac Allister converted a penalty on seven minutes and then Darwin Nunez scored two outstanding goals on 25 and 45+3 minutes to send in the visitors with a three goal advantage at the interval. 

To be fair to Sparta Prague, that scoreline was a little harsh, but the home side struck back immediately after half time when Conor Bradley could only turn a cross into his own net after 46 minutes to make the scoreline 3-1 in favor of Liverpool . 

Luis Diaz restored Liverpool's three goal lead in the 53rd minute and Mo Salah had a goal disallowed for offside before Dominik Szoboszlai rattled home the fifth in the 90+4th minute of the game.
